Don't limit your transformation content to just the face. Pin your mood boards and outfit inspirations on Pinterest to drive traffic back to your main profile. This helps you capture an audience looking for aesthetic inspiration before they even know who you are.
Pillar 2: Performance and Personality
While photos are static, drag is alive. You need to prove you can entertain. TikTok is the perfect place for short, punchy lip-sync performances and comedy skits. The key here is consistency. You are building a character that people want to invite into their homes every day.
For longer-form content, upload full performance tapes or detailed storytimes to YouTube. This is where you monetize your deeper connection with fans. You can discuss the history of the drag scene, which allows you to tap into the educational side of the culture while still being entertaining.

Eventually, you need to get paid. Treat your drag career like a business. Update your LinkedIn profile to reflect your work as a professional entertainer and public speaker. This helps you land corporate gigs or Diversity and Inclusion speaking panels, which pay significantly more than a typical Friday night show.
Use Facebook to join local event groups and promote your upcoming appearances. It remains the best place for local event discovery. Connect with venue owners and promoters directly via WhatsApp to secure bookings. A direct message is often more effective than a tagged comment.
Finally, consider streaming your "Get Ready With Me" sessions on Twitch. This allows fans to tip you in real-time while you apply your makeup or sew a costume, creating an additional revenue stream.

What exactly defines drag performance and culture?
Drag is a performance art where individuals, often men, exaggerate feminine attributes through clothing and makeup for entertainment. It is a diverse culture that includes lip-syncing, live singing, comedy, and often challenges traditional gender norms. This art form serves as a powerful outlet for self-expression and social commentary within the LGBTQ+ community.
How can I find local drag shows or performers to support?
The best approach is to check event listings at local LGBTQ+ bars or community centers, which frequently host these performances. You should also search for specific performers on Instagram to see their tour dates and promotional content. Following regional drag pages on Facebook is another smart way to stay updated on upcoming themed nights and events.
